Transaction dc3dac6e4c2153542cba373b051ea5a55bb6fa7148b363fa2fcf680753cb187e
1 Input
2 Outputs
- dc3dac6e4c2153542cba373b051ea5a55bb6fa7148b363fa2fcf680753cb187e:0
- dc3dac6e4c2153542cba373b051ea5a55bb6fa7148b363fa2fcf680753cb187e:1
value 17189548
address 19bCD8fmHKidtDLDrQuiX2tBAo9dmhCpRF
value 100000000
address 1KEjtosdEFSzLVpWx14vQ1NRvXF8cnTtKP